What is EBCDIC in SAP BC-ABA - ABAP Runtime Environment?


SAP Term: EBCDIC

  • Component: BC-ABA

  • Component Name: ABAP Runtime Environment

  • Description: Abbreviation for Extended Binary Coded Decimal Interchange Code. 8 bit character set based on BCD. EBCDIC contains most of the same characters as ASCII.

  • Key Concepts: 
    EBCDIC (Extended Binary Coded Decimal Interchange Code) is a character encoding system used by IBM mainframe computers. It is an 8-bit character encoding that is used to represent text and numeric data. It is used in the BC-ABA ABAP Runtime Environment to store and transfer data between different systems.

    Related Information: 
    EBCDIC is similar to ASCII (American Standard Code for Information Interchange), which is another character encoding system used by computers. Both EBCDIC and ASCII are used to represent text and numeric data, but they are not compatible with each other.
